This web page is just another view of the content of www.mwlist.org, a unique database of worldwide radio stations on longwave, mediumwave and shortwave. MWLIST powers various things like the mediumwave section of fmscan.org, the mwoffsets file, a userlist for Perseus, and an online logbook site. Such a global database did not exist before. It was created following the example of FMLIST. It is a non-commercial and hobby project and open for everyone to contribute and use. We understand that maintaining the database is time-consuming for a single person, but may be practical for a team of dedicated users from all over the world. We are inviting everyone interested to join and to make this database a useful tool for all DXers and radio enthusiasts.
